What's Happening?
Sling TV has positioned itself as a viable option for streaming Premier League soccer in the United States. The service's Blue plan, priced at $46 per month, includes access to USA Network, which broadcasts
Premier League matches. This plan offers over 40 channels, including sports networks like ESPN and FS1. The upcoming match between Brighton and Newcastle will be available on USA Network, accessible through Sling TV and other streaming services. Additionally, viewers traveling abroad can use a VPN to maintain access to their streaming services, enhancing privacy and security.
